set_data()
This nonblocking procedure sets a data field array element for a master transaction that is
uniquely identified by the transaction_id field previously created by the
create_master_transaction() procedure.
The data byte is identified by the optional index argument. If no index is supplied, then the first
data byte is accessed in the array.
Example
-- Create a master transaction containing 3 transfers.
-- Creation returns tr_id to identify the transaction.
create_master_transaction(3, tr_id, bfm_index,
axi4stream_tr_if_0(bfm_index));
-- Set the data field to 2 for the first byte
-- of the tr_id transaction.
set_data(2, 0, tr_id, bfm_index, axi4stream_tr_if_0(bfm_index));
-- Set the data field to 3 for the second byte
-- of the tr_id transaction.
set_data(3, 1, tr_id, bfm_index, axi4stream_tr_if_0(bfm_index));
Prototype
set_data
(
data: in integer;
index : in integer; --optional
transaction_id : in integer;
bfm_id : in integer;
signal tr_if : inout axi4stream_vhd_if_struct_t
);
Arguments
data Data byte.
index (Optional) Array element index number for data.
transaction_id Transaction identifier. Refer to “Overloaded Procedure Common
Arguments” on page 87 for more details.
bfm_id BFM identifier. Refer to “Overloaded Procedure Common Arguments”
on page 87 for more details.
tr_if Transaction signal interface. Refer to “Overloaded Procedure Common
Arguments” on page 87 for more details.
Returns
None
